History

This location used to be the site of Fort Menendez at The Old Florida Museum.  There was never a real fort at this location but the building and attractions offered family-friendly interactive history demonstrations, hands on activities and reenactments.  The Old Florida Museum has been moved to The Florida Agricultural Legacy  Learning Center, leaving the Fort to deteriorate and become overgrown.  Photos on TripAdvisor show the well-kept and interactive family attraction.
